#14  POODLE

Poodles as gun dogs?! That’s exactly what they were originally bred to be. Reputed to be the most intelligent of all dog breeds, the standard poodle is a loyal and keen canine, and a true pleasure to train. Remarkably versatile dogs with plenty of stamina and impressive agility, they are well suited for the pursuit of both upland game birds and waterfowl.

First developed in Germany more than 400 years ago for retrieving ducks, the poodle is a strong swimmer with a naturally curly, water-resistant coat. The national dog of France, where it’s known as the caniche, or “duck dog,” the poodle comes in three colours: white, black or apricot. As an added bonus, this breed rarely sheds it coat and is considered to be hypoallergenic.
